There are two ways to ride a wakeboard. 1
1. Edging and driving through the wake where your speed from attack angle and pop will determine your lift. This requires a higher skill level because you’re dealing with different forces from the pull of the line and the timing of your jump.
2. Riding a thinner profiled board with more top water speed and less line load. This style creates a pendulum using more of a natural centripetal approach with less effort both on and leaving the water.
New for 2022 Ronix put the Krush on a diet and took almost 20% of the weight out. Now a rider has more feedback with the water, less swing weight in the air, and easier transitioned turns. For over 20 years they have been designing boards recognizing that your shoulders and hips are not always parallel in wakeboarding. Your body is crossed up riding toeside, and more inline riding heelside, and every aspect of the Krush takes this into consideration for the proper foundation to your riding.

Rocker: 3-stage
An exaggerated rocker line with a later arc and a higher degree provides a more straight up explosive pop. This style of rocker creates more of an instant buck off the wake (combine that with our Blackout Technology to experience everything a wake has to offer), for riders that are behind a big boat wake. Wakeboarders riding behind smaller wakes will still feel like they are getting a solid kick as well.
Energy: Stored 3
Created for a rider who approaches and leaves the wake the way a snowboarder would a kicker or a skater would an ollie. The delay in the energy means the rider is given more time to generate the full lift from the power building from the tip all the way to the tail of the board. If riders don’t have that snow / skate timing off the wake – no problem – they will just have a mellower lift. A construction that’s easier on your body.
